Principal Software Engineer

Join Our Team as a Principal Software Engineer!

Location: Great Baddow – Enjoy flexible working arrangements, including part-time options and the ability to accrue hours. Let’s discuss what works best for you!

Salary: Up to £75,900, based on your skills and experience.

What You’ll Be Doing:

As a Principal Software Engineer, you will play a pivotal role in shaping our software solutions. Your responsibilities will include:

  • Deriving and maintaining software requirements from a baseline set of systems requirements.
  • Producing and maintaining software designs that meet these requirements.
  • Transforming designs into deliverable software solutions.
  • Conducting peer reviews and verifying solutions across Maritime Services.
  • Leading technical reviews and authorizing software engineering designs.
  • Acting as the Engineering technical lead for software solutions at a sub-system level.
  • Maintaining software solutions to address defects and add new functionalities.
  • Supporting the development of individuals and teams to enhance skills and competencies.
  • Assisting in the creation of software estimates for sub-systems.
Your Skills and Experiences:

We’re looking for candidates who bring a wealth of experience and knowledge, including:

  • Proficiency in at least one high-level programming language.
  • Extensive experience with high-level design methodologies, particularly UML.
  • Strong understanding of the software lifecycle and various models (e.g., Waterfall, Agile).
  • A BEng/BSc in Computer Science or a related Engineering or Numerate subject.
  • Familiarity with software standards (e.g., ISO/IEC/IEE 12207).
  • Knowledge of Ada95 is a plus.
  • Chartered Engineer (CEng) status or working towards it.
  • Comprehensive understanding of configuration management and experience with related tools.
  • Understanding of model-based techniques is advantageous.
Benefits That Matter:

At BAE Systems, we believe in rewarding our team members. In addition to a competitive pension scheme, you’ll enjoy:

  • Employee share plans.
  • An extensive range of flexible health, wellbeing, and lifestyle benefits.
  • A green car scheme and private health plans.
  • Shopping discounts and potential eligibility for an annual incentive.
About the Sampson Radar Software Team:

Join a dynamic team of over 30 professionals dedicated to supporting and upgrading capabilities for the Royal Navy. In this role, you will deliver software products and enhancements over the next decade while providing ongoing support for existing products. This is a fantastic opportunity to develop your skills and potentially step into more senior positions within a global business.

Why Choose BAE Systems?

Here, you can truly make a difference! We foster an inclusive culture that values diverse perspectives, rewards integrity, and empowers you to reach your full potential. We welcome individuals from all backgrounds and strive to make our recruitment processes as inclusive as possible. If you have a disability or health condition that may affect your performance, we encourage you to discuss potential reasonable adjustments with us.

Important Security Information: Many roles at BAE Systems are subject to security and export control restrictions. Factors such as nationality and residency may affect your eligibility for certain positions. All applicants must meet the Baseline Personnel Security Standard, with many roles requiring higher levels of National Security Vetting.

Closing Date: 25th November 2025

We may close this vacancy early if we receive sufficient applications, so don’t wait—submit your application as soon as possible!

#LI-TP1

#LI-Onsite

Company
BAE Systems
Location
Billericay, Essex, UK
Posted
Company
BAE Systems
Location
Billericay, Essex, UK
Posted